Ivorian football mourns the loss of Sory Diabaté

Sory Diabaté, a prominent figure in Ivorian football, has passed away, leaving the nation’s football community in deep mourning. The former vice-president of the Ivorian Football Federation (FIF) and president of the Professional Football League died on Thursday morning after a prolonged illness, marking a significant loss for the sport in Côte d’Ivoire.

Diabaté was a central figure in the administration and development of football in the country, known for his dedication and leadership.

His passing comes as a painful reminder of the loss felt by the Ivorian football community just a few years ago when former FIF president Sidy Diallo also passed away.

Throughout his career, Diabaté was deeply involved in the sport, contributing to its growth and success at various levels.

His last major public engagement was during the FIF elections, where Yacine Idriss Diallo was elected as the new president.

These elections marked the end of an era for Diabaté, who had been a steadfast presence in Ivorian football for many years.
